A woman in her 80s has become the first person with the new coronavirus to die in Japan, the country’s health minister said Thursday, cautioning it was not clear if the virus caused her death.

“The relationship between the new coronavirus and the death of the person is still unclear,” Katsunobu Kato said at a late-night briefing, adding that “this is the first death of a person who tested positive.”

According to reports in the Japanese media, the virus was only identified after the patient’s death. The victim was not from the cruise ship quarantined near Tokyo.

This makes the third death from the COVID-19 virus, first found in the Chinese city of Wuhan, outside mainland China, with the other two deaths happening in Hong Kong and the Philippines.
